Second Post

Here is the link to the New York Times “front pages” that my group created: https://blogs.baruch.cuny.edu/nytfastfood/

My group decided to explore how fast food affects people’s life in our New York Times “front page”. This is important to our first semester at Baruch because as we start our college life, we are more likely to eat in a fast food restaurant instead of cooking for ourselves. Most of us are lazy. Fast food is a lot cheaper and affordable to many college students.

There are 7 post in total, one of them is about the obesity cause by consuming fast food in China; one of them is about the calories in fast food; one of them is about how Americans’ diet changed over time; two of the are about the fast food strike that just happen recently in both local and national level and the last post is advocating for consuming healthy food.

We choose to post these articles because we want to discuss how the health problem is not the only concern we should have regard to the fast food, how the fast food industries treat its employee should also be the concern.
